Transaction 77107f0fd5cffc8607d6d690a8c7077d4017b8cd4b1bae5e09fdd5ec10026599

1 Input
2 Outputs
  • 77107f0fd5cffc8607d6d690a8c7077d4017b8cd4b1bae5e09fdd5ec10026599:0
  • value  1256300
    address  3Qz7ud5Ta3mKYSdqHHjToLRW6UHHrJq9RT
  • 77107f0fd5cffc8607d6d690a8c7077d4017b8cd4b1bae5e09fdd5ec10026599:1
  • value  33675
    address  1PtzAxCevZPS4fySFZeovPfuAFKGiRV4V7